EDITORS COMMENTS
This print captures the essence of Colomba, a character from Prosper Merimee's renowned novel. Illustrated by Gaston Vuillier, this engraving brings to life Colomba's intriguing personality and her pivotal role in orchestrating a vendetta. In the image, we see Colomba portrayed as a young woman with an air of shyness, her headscarf delicately framing her face. Her clasped hands suggest both innocence and determination as she gazes coyly at the viewer. A subtle smile plays on her lips, hinting at the hidden depths within. Colomba's Corsican heritage is evident through her attire and surroundings. The rugged landscape of Corsica serves as a backdrop for this scene, emphasizing the island's wild beauty that mirrors Colomba's passionate spirit. The photograph beautifully captures Colomba’s manipulative nature as she plots revenge alongside her brother Orso Antonio. With calculated precision, she urges him to partake in their family vendetta – a task that will forever change their lives. This evocative image not only showcases Vuillier’s artistic talent but also highlights the timeless allure of Merimee’s characters. It invites us into their world filled with intrigue and suspense while reminding us of the power one person can wield when driven by vengeance.
